Flooding to peak in Wilmington area this week

9/24/18–
Imagine having to wait for vital supplies to reach you by boat.
It’s a reality for many folks nearby.
Some people near the border of New Hanover and Pender counties are still cut off from the outside world due to flooding.
One woman in Rocky Point worries sunny skies mean people forget about those who live behind the “road closed” sign.
Flooding in this area is expected to be at its peak this week.
